Historical Context of Automation
Revolutions in technology and automation are not new ideas. When the Industrial Revolution started, many people were afraid that they would lose their jobs since companies were starting to replace manual labour with machines. Similar worries were raised about the obsolescence of human computation, typing, and bookkeeping as computers developed in the 20th century. Still, during both of these eras, new industries, jobs, and even higher productivity were created. When it comes to computers, for instance, new professions like digital marketers, IT professionals, and software developers have emerged even though certain employment have vanished.
AI is frequently compared to these earlier advances in technology. Automation may appear to be a danger to human labour at first, but history demonstrates that technology has also created jobs. Innovation gives rise to new industries, professions, and roles in society. How society and corporations respond to these developments will be crucial in shaping the future of AI jobs. The rise of AI jobs could mirror the way earlier revolutions introduced new work opportunities alongside technological growth.

Jobs Most Likely to Be Affected by AI
Certain jobs are more vulnerable to AI-driven automation, especially those that involve routine, repetitive tasks. Here’s a look at the sectors most at risk:
Routine and Repetitive Tasks
AI automation is best suited for jobs that require repeated, rule-based operations to be completed. For example, robotics and AI systems are already automating activities for data entry clerks and factory workers. These tasks, which formerly required human labour, are now precisely completed by machines that are more productive, affordable, and require no breaks. The rise of AI jobs in programming and maintaining these systems is increasing as the demand for automation grows.
Retail and Transportation
Automation is also having a negative impact on the transportation and retail industries. Self-checkout devices are becoming more and more popular, which eliminates the need for human cashiers. The development of autonomous cars additionally presents a threat to delivery workers, truck drivers, and taxi drivers’ livelihoods. Large corporations are making investments in autonomous cars, which, if widely used, would result in a large loss of jobs in this industry. However, new AI jobs related to managing and developing autonomous technology may emerge alongside these shifts.

The Rise of New Jobs Due to AI
While some jobs will be displaced, AI is also creating new job opportunities. Many of these roles revolve around developing, maintaining, and overseeing AI systems. Below are some examples:
AI Development and Maintenance
As more companies adopt AI, positions like machine learning professionals, data scientists, and AI engineers are already in high demand. To ensure that AI models are built, trained, and improved upon for optimal performance, businesses need skilled professionals. These roles contribute to the creation and management of AI jobs, which are key to sustaining the technology’s growth.
AI Ethics and Oversight
Concerns regarding the ethics of using AI are becoming more common as technology develops, especially in relation to issues like decision-making, bias, and data privacy. This has led to the emergence of positions like AI ethicists, whose role is to ensure that AI systems are used in a transparent and ethical manner, addressing concerns around fairness and responsibility. These jobs are essential in safeguarding how AI is integrated into everyday life.
Augmentation of Human Work
AI is enhancing rather than replacing professionals in fields such as healthcare, particularly in medical diagnostics. Doctors can focus more on patient care by leveraging AI tools to assist with analyzing medical data. Similarly, in creative industries, AI tools support writers, filmmakers, and artists without replacing them, complementing their work. The rise of AI jobs in these sectors is a testament to how AI augments human capabilities rather than supplanting them.

The Importance of Upskilling
As artificial intelligence reshapes the workforce, employees must acquire new skills to effectively support and work alongside AI systems. Skills such as data literacy, AI management, and creative problem-solving will become increasingly valuable in the future. This shift emphasizes the need for a workforce prepared for the rise of AI jobs that require specialized knowledge and adaptability.
Retraining Workers
Both businesses and individuals need to invest in continuous education and training to remain competitive. Workers in industries like retail and transportation, which are at a higher risk of AI displacement, should focus on developing skills in project management, technology, or more cognitively demanding jobs. Reskilling efforts are crucial to ensure employees transition smoothly into new AI job opportunities.
Industries Where Human Skills Matter
AI is still far from replicating the complex human talents required in industries that rely on leadership, emotional intelligence, and intricate decision-making. In professions like counseling, corporate leadership, and the creative arts, human intuition and experience are irreplaceable. AI may assist, but it cannot fully replace the nuance of human judgment and creativity in these fields.

Ethical and Social Implications
As AI adoption grows, there are significant ethical and social considerations that governments and companies must address to ensure the transition is fair for all workers, particularly in relation to AI jobs.
Job Security and Fair Wages
Governments and businesses must collaborate to prevent workers from losing their jobs or seeing wage reductions as the economy becomes more AI-driven. One approach to mitigate job displacement is the introduction of a Universal Basic Income (UBI), which could provide financial support to those affected by automation, including displaced workers from AI jobs.
Redistribution of Wealth
The increased productivity resulting from AI advancements should not solely benefit shareholders and company owners. Policymakers need to explore wealth redistribution mechanisms to ensure that workers also benefit from technological progress. It’s essential to create equitable systems where gains from AI are shared broadly, preventing growing income inequality as AI reshapes the job market.
